Overview
Swiss Chalets Village Inn is a resort hotel done in a traditional Swiss style with casual, comfortable rooms, and plenty of facilities for a family vacation, including an outdoor pool and picnic area. Located in the White Mountains of New Hampshire, the resort is surrounded by outdoor activities, including skiing at Black Mountain ski area and the Mount Washington Cog Railway.
The rooms at Swiss Chalets Village Inn are simple, but nicely appointed and are available in standard economy or suites that feature a fireplace and a jacuzzi. All rooms include a 40" TV, microwave and minifridge, individual climate control, and a coffee maker. Pet-friendly rooms can be reserved via phone, not on the website.
The facilities at Swiss Chalets Village Inn provide lots of activities for any vacationer, including a picnic and barbecue area, outdoor pool, a fitness center, and a game room.
Swiss Chalets Village Inn is close to a wealth of attractions and activities. The hotel is an 11-minute drive from Black Mountain ski area, a 9-minute drive from Attitash Mountain Resort, 4 minutes from Story Land amusement park, and 45 minutes from Mount Washington Cog Railway, a mountain-climbing cog railway which carries guests to the top of Mount Washington using steam and bio-diesel.
Set in a picturesque part of New Hampshire perfect for a family vacation or romantic getaway and filled with activities and attractions, Swiss Chalets Village Inn is a pleasant and affordable place to stay.
